Cypress Jade Agricultural Holdings Limited provided earnings guidance for the year ended December 31, 2014. The Group is expected to record a substantial increase in net loss of approximately HKD 102 million for the year ended 31 December 2014, as compared to the net loss for the year ended 31 December 2013. Such loss was mainly as a result of a substantial decrease in gross profit of approximately HKD 35 million; and a substantial increase in impairment losses recognized for goodwill of and property, plant and equipment approximately HKD 72 million.

Based on the relevant information currently available to the Board, the increase in net loss for the year ended 31 December 2014 was mainly attributable to the inclement weather in the year 2014; the decrease in the average selling price and demand in the vegetable markets in Hong Kong and China; the one-off office relocation expenses in China resulting from business restructuring; and an increase in impairment loss of goodwill and property, plant and equipment for the year ended 31 December 2014.
